Permit Requirements: El Cajon vs Elfin Forest

How do permit requirements rules compare between El Cajon, CA and Elfin Forest, CA?

El Cajon has fewer restrictions than Elfin Forest.

El Cajon, CA

San Diego County

Some Restrictions

El Cajon requires a short-term rental permit under Municipal Code Section 17.120 and a TOT certificate. ADUs may not be used for STRs. Compliance with noise, parking, and occupancy regulations is mandatory.

Elfin Forest, CA

San Diego County

Heavy Restrictions

San Diego County requires a Short-Term Residential Occupancy (STRO) permit for vacation rentals in unincorporated areas under Zoning Ordinance Section 6900 et seq. Both hosted and un-hosted rentals need permits. Operators must obtain a TOT certificate and maintain good neighbor policies.
